| Version | Text | 
| Hebrew | בחשבם להיות מורי תורה ואינם מבינים מה הם אמרים ומה הם מחליטים׃ | 
| Greek | θελοντες ειναι νομοδιδασκαλοι μη νοουντες μητε α λεγουσιν μητε περι τινων διαβεβαιουνται | 
| Latin | volentes esse legis doctores, non intelligentes neque quæ loquuntur, neque de quibus affirmant. | 
| KJV | Desiring to be teachers of the law; understanding neither what they say, nor whereof they affirm. | 
| WEB | desiring to be teachers of the law, though they understand neither what they say, nor about what they strongly affirm. |
